I was using one standard dell monitor and every so often it would go into power saving mode, my computer would still be running as I could hear the sound and my friends in on-line games said I was still connected to the server. I tried turning off all the power-saving options and any other control panel settings which could affect this.

I then plugged in my second monitor to see if it was a monitor issue but now I have both connected and they both have the same problem intermittently.

Recently it has been flicking on and off quickly for a while before it goes dead and into the power saving mode.

Does anyone know how to rectify this? I pretty sure it's not a monitor issue when I have tried two monitors and they both present the same issue.

I had this problem when I stuck my 4850 into my old dell rig. Figured it was to do with the card not getting enough power because the power supply was 350w and I had a q6600 4gb of ram 2 hdd a dvd-rw and of course the graphics card. Put the card in my HTPC with similar specs but with a 450W power supply problem solved.

Either that or the graphics card is over heating
